                              With 36 names, at least, to be announced in the All Blacks squad this Monday, it's unlikely there will be a host of wildly unpredictable selections or shock omissions.

                              We can expect a few new names, possibly Leicester Fainga'anuku, and maybe Salesi Ryasi and Finlay Christie, while Brodie Retallick, David Havili and Braydon Ennor should all return after not being involved last year for various reasons.

                              But 2021 isn't a fresh start year. The door isn't closed to new arrivals, but having only been able to play six tests last year, All Blacks coach Ian Foster has his sights set on building the experience and ability of the group he mostly used last year.
